B.Tech. in Mechatronics Engineering at Sanjivani College of Engineering is chosen for its strong industry connect, legacy of providing best engineering education since 1983, and the scope of mechatronics in industry 4.0, robotics, IoT, AI, automotive automation, and home appliance automation. Mechatronics engineers can work across multiple engineering disciplines and have a solid base to grow and supersede in their careers. The branch has senior and experienced multidisciplinary blended faculty and innovative labs in the field.

The college is moderately strict when it comes to the eligibility requirements of BTech in Computer Engineering at Sanjivani College of Engineering. The c&idate should have passed 10+2 with Physics & Math & one subject from Chemistry/Biology/Biotech/CS/IT/etc. with a minimum of 45% (Open), 40% (Reserved/EWS/PWD Maharashtra) in the above subjects. They must also have a non-zero score in MHT-CET 2025 (PCM Group) or Sanjivani University Entrance Test 2025 or PERA or JEE.

The eligibility criteria for admission to Sanjivani College of Engineering for B.Tech. in Civil Engineering are as follows:
- The candidate should be an Indian National.
- The candidate should have passed the HSC (Std. XII) examination of Maharashtra State Board of Secondary and Higher Secondary Education or its equivalent examination with subjects English,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ics.
- The candidate should have obtained a minimum of 50% marks (45% for backward class candidates from Maharashtra) in the subjects of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ics added together.
- The candidate should have a valid score in MHT-CET or JEE Main (Paper I).
- The admissions are effected by the Directorate of Technical Education, Maharashtra State, Mumbai, and detailed rules and information are available in the information brochure published by them.

To get a seat in Sanjivani College of Engineering for B.Tech. in Computer Engineering, follow these steps:
1. Check the eligibility criteria: The candidate should have passed 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ics as compulsory subjects.
2. Entrance exam: Appear for the MHT-CET (Maharashtra Common Entrance Test) or JEE Main exam.
3. Counseling: Participate in the counseling process conducted by the State Common Entrance Test Cell, Maharashtra.
4. Seat allocation: Seats are allocated based on the merit list prepared by the counseling authority.
5. Admission: Once a seat is allocated, report to the college for admission and complete the necessary formalities.
Note: The intake for B.Tech. Computer Engineering at Sanjivani College of Engineering is 120 seats.

To get a seat in Sanjivani College of Pharmaceutical Education and Research for Bachelor of Pharmacy (B.Pharma.), you should contact the institute for admission, as the college has a place among the top and most-preferred educational institutes in the country. The Bachelor of Pharmacy course is a 4-year programme (semester pattern) affiliated with Savitribai Phule Pune University, with an intake of 120 students.
